ROUTINE INSPECTION

6 reported violations
  • K07: Proper hot and cold holding temperatures

    Tofu with water at the prep table was measured 50F. Per employee, water was added into the tofu. [CA] PHFs shall be held at 41°F or below or at 135°F or above. [SA] Add chilled water to maintain the temperature at 41F and below. Raw marinated chicken was measured 45F. [CA] PHFs shall be held at 41°F or below or at 135°F or above. [SA] Always keep the drawer closed to maintained temperature at 41F and below.

  • K34: Warewash facilities: installed/maintained; test strips

    Lack test strips. [CA] Testing equipment and materials shall be provided to adequately measure the applicable sanitization method used during manual or mechanical warewashing.

  • K21: Hot and cold water available

    Hot running water at the handwashing sink in the restroom was measured 75F. [CA] Handwashing facilities equipped with a mixing valve that is not readily adjustable at the faucet, shall provide warm water at least 100°F, but not greater than 108°F.

  • K39: Thermometers provided, accurate

    Lack probe thermometer. NOTE: Must check chicken temperature after frying. [CA] An accurate easily readable metal probe thermometer (accurate to +/- 2°F) that is designed to measure the temperature of thin masses shall be provided and readily available to accurately measure the temperatures of potentially hazardous foods.

  • K41: Plumbing approved, installed, in good repair; proper backflow devices

    Drain pipe of the food prep sink next to the dishwasher is inside the floor sink. [CA] All equipment that discharges liquid waste shall be drained by means of indirect waste pipes, and all wastes drained by them shall discharge through an airgap into a floor sink or other approved type of receptor. [SA] Trim pipe to provide minimum 1 inch air gap.

  • K06: Adequate handwash facilities supplied, accessible

    Empty paper towel dispenser for the hand washing sink next to a dishwasher. [CA] Single-use sanitary towels shall be provided in dispensers; heated-air hand drying device may be substituted for single-use towels. Lack soap dispenser inside the restroom. Pump soap in use. [CA] Provide handwashing cleanser in dispenser at handwash stations at all times.

ROUTINE INSPECTION

6 reported violations
  • K34: Warewash facilities: installed/maintained; test strips

    Lack sanitizer test strips. [CA] Testing equipment and materials shall be readily available at all times.

  • K23: No rodents, insects, birds, or animals

    One dead cockroach was observed between wall and refrigeration. [CA] Clean and sanitize area of dead cockroaches. Keep working with the pest control service to eliminate the problem.

  • K06: Adequate handwash facilities supplied, accessible

    Two out of one hand washing sink has a broken paper towel dispenser and facility is using paper towel roll. [CA] Properly wash hands with soap, warm water and dry using single use paper towels from a paper towel dispenser as required.

  • K30: Food storage: food storage containers identified

    Large pot of curry without lid inside the refrigeration. [CA] Store open bulk foods in approved NSF containers with tight fitting lids. Eggs cartons were stored above chicken and pork containers. [CA] Always keep eggs on the bottom shelve to prevent cross contamination.

  • K38: Adequate ventilation/lighting; designated areas, use

    Dust debris on the restroom vent. [CA] Clean restroom vent from dust debris.

  • K47: Signs posted; last inspection report available

    Expired health permit was on display [CA] The valid health permit issued by this department shall be posted in a conspicuous place in the food facility.
